The Construction and Engineering Department at Coleg Meirion-Dwyfor is a forward-thinking department offering courses across a range of disciplines. Teaching and learning take place using industry-standard equipment and in modern facilities. Within the department, we have two sites: Hafan (Pwllheli) and CaMDA (Dolgellau), both of which deliver Engineering qualifications.

We are seeking a part-time permanent (equivalent to two days a week) member of staff to join the Engineering side of the department; and we are ready to employ an enthusiastic and motivated individual with experience in areas related to General Engineering and Fabrication & Welding. At present, we have excellent lecturers in mechanical engineering, manufacturing engineering, machining and welding, and we are looking for a member of staff who will complement this. The successful candidate will be expected to deliver high standards of teaching and learning and to provide ongoing support, advice and guidance to learners that promote success. We would like to work with you to develop your skills to provide the best possible experience for learners, and to help move the department forward.
